Job Description

We are seeking a diligent and detail-oriented Protocol Officer to join our team in Maryborough. This role is integral to the successful planning and execution of government diplomatic events, official visits, and ceremonial duties within the Queensland Government framework. The successful candidate will work closely with various government departments, diplomatic missions, and external stakeholders to ensure all events adhere to strict protocol guidelines, cultural sensitivities, and logistical requirements. This is an exciting opportunity for an individual with exceptional organisational skills and a keen interest in international relations and government administration.

Key Responsibilities

  • Coordinate and manage logistical arrangements for diplomatic visits, official ceremonies, and government functions, ensuring adherence to established protocol.
  • Prepare comprehensive briefing materials, itineraries, and programs for dignitaries and senior government officials.
  • Liaise effectively with internal departments, diplomatic missions, and external vendors to facilitate smooth event execution.
  • Provide expert advice on matters of protocol, etiquette, and precedence to ensure appropriate conduct at all events.
  • Manage guest lists, invitations, and RSVPs, and coordinate seating plans and gift exchanges in accordance with protocol.
  • Act as a point of contact for diplomatic representatives and high-level visitors, providing support and assistance as required.
  • Oversee event setup, delivery, and post-event reporting, including financial reconciliation and feedback collection.
  • Maintain up-to-date knowledge of international protocol standards and best practices.
